 Preliminary Datasheet
RJK5030DPD
Silicon N Channel MOS FET High Speed Power Switching
Features
Low on-state resistance RDS(on) = 1.3 typ. (at ID = 2 A, VGS = 10 V, Ta = 25C) High speed switching REJ03G1913-0100 Rev.1.00 Apr 12, 2010

Absolute Maximum Ratings
(Ta = 25C)
Item Drain to source voltage Gate to source voltage Drain current Drain peak current Avalanche current Channel dissipation Channel to case thermal Impedance Channel temperature Storage temperature Notes: 1. Pulse width limited by safe operating area. 2. Value at Tc = 25C 3. STch = 25C, Tch 150C Symbol VDSS VGSS ID ID (pulse) Note3 IAP Pch Note 2 ch-c Tch Tstg
Note1
Value 500 30 5 20 5 41.7 3.0 150 -55 to +150
Unit V V A A A W C/W C C

Electrical Characteristics
(Ta = 25C)
Item Drain to source breakdown voltage Zero gate voltage drain current Gate to source leak current Gate to source cutoff voltage Static drain to source on state resistance Input capacitance Output capacitance Reverse transfer capacitance Turn-on delay time Rise time Turn-off delay time Fall time Body-drain diode forward voltage Body-drain diode reverse recovery time Symbol V (BR) DSS IDSS IGSS VGS (off) RDS (on) Ciss Coss Crss td (on) tr td (off) tf VDF trr Min 500 -- -- 3.5 -- -- -- -- -- -- -- -- -- -- Typ -- -- -- -- 1.3 550 60 10 15 20 90 30 0.9 250 Max -- 10 0.1 4.5 1.6 -- -- -- -- -- -- -- 1.5 -- Unit V A A V pF pF pF ns ns ns ns V ns Test Conditions ID = 1 mA, VGS = 0 VDS = 500 V, VGS = 0 VGS = 25 V, VDS = 0 VDS = 10 V, ID = 1 mA ID = 2 A, VGS = 10 V Note 4 VDS = 25 V VGS = 0 f = 1 MHz VDD = 200 V ID = 2 A VGS = 10 V Rg = 25 IF = 5 A, VGS = 0 Note 4 IF = 5 A, VGS = 0 VDD = 250 V diF/dt = 100 A/s
Note:
4. Pulse test

Renesas Electronics products are classified according to the following three quality grades: "Standard", "High Quality", and "Specific". The recommended applications for each Renesas Electronics product depends on the product's quality grade, as indicated below. You must check the quality grade of each Renesas Electronics product before using it in a particular application. You may not use any Renesas Electronics product for any application categorized as "Specific" without the prior written consent of Renesas Electronics. Further, you may not use any Renesas Electronics product for any application for which it is not intended without the prior written consent of Renesas Electronics. Renesas Electronics shall not be in any way liable for any damages or losses incurred by you or third parties arising from the use of any Renesas Electronics product for an application categorized as "Specific" or for which the product is not intended where you have failed to obtain the prior written consent of Renesas Electronics. The quality grade of each Renesas Electronics product is "Standard" unless otherwise expressly specified in a Renesas Electronics data sheets or data books, etc. "Standard": Computers; office equipment; communications equipment; test and measurement equipment; audio and visual equipment; home electronic appliances; machine tools; personal electronic equipment; and industrial robots. "High Quality": Transportation equipment (automobiles, trains, ships, etc.); traffic control systems; anti-disaster systems; anti-crime systems; safety equipment; and medical equipment not specifically designed for life support. "Specific": Aircraft; aerospace equipment; submersible repeaters; nuclear reactor control systems; medical equipment or systems for life support (e.g. artificial life support devices or systems), surgical implantations, or healthcare intervention (e.g. excision, etc.), and any other applications or purposes that pose a direct threat to human life. 8.
